The EHRA 2021 Online Congress is a premier educational event organized by the European Heart Rhythm Association, bringing together world-renowned electrophysiologists, cardiologists, researchers, and allied professionals to explore the latest advances in cardiac rhythm management, electrophysiology, cardiac devices, and arrhythmia care.
Centered around the theme “Making Connections to Overcome Arrhythmia”, the congress emphasized collaboration between subspecialties, generations of electrophysiologists, and multidisciplinary healthcare teams to improve patient outcomes and advance the field of cardiac electrophysiology.
The program features extensive scientific sessions, clinical updates, case-based discussions, guideline reviews, debates, and late-breaking research covering every aspect of heart rhythm disorders and their management.
